Job Description The candidate will participate in the testing of data application solutions for GEMS two-way radio systems by developing and executing application level tests and supporting system level testing. The candidate will participate in the testing of data applications in both small and large system designs that involve multiple configurations as defined by multi-generation system release roadmaps. The testing of specific localizations of globalized software will also be performed. The primary responsibility for this candidate will be the development (both Test Plans and Test Cases) and execution of acceptance and integration tests for location services and/or text messaging applications. This will include functional, performance tests, and API/protocol level tests. Developing test software, possibly involving automated test software, will also be part of the candidate’s responsibilities. The candidate will communicate with various development team members and technical staff to ensure that test requirements and limitations are understood, accounted for, and appropriately acted upon. The candidate will also participate in the continuous improvement of the development process. Specific Knowledge: Minimum of a BSEE degree or equivalent. Demonstrated test plan, test case, and test execution ability is required. Domain knowledge in the area of Geographical Information Systems (GIS) and/or text messaging protocols is desirable. Experience in testing localized software is desired. Software development skills and familiarity with Windows environment and Windows development tools is also desirable. The ability to work as a team member, with strong inter-personal and communications (written/verbal) skills, is required.
